Nettet1. jul. 2024 · We will set up NextJS 12 with Typescript, Chakra UI, ESLint, Prettier, Lint-staged, React Testing Library, Vitest and Playwirght in VSCode Nettet29. jun. 2024 · If ESLint is installed globally, then make sure eslint-plugin-prettier is also installed globally. A globally-installed ESLint cannot find a locally-installed plugin. If ESLint is installed locally, then it's likely that the plugin isn't installed correctly. Try reinstalling by running the following: npm i eslint-plugin-prettier@latest --save-dev

Turning off default Visual Studio Code parser and just leaving the eslint parser on save fixed it for me. Just go to settings Ctrl/Cmd + ,, choose User (global settings) or Workspace (only for the working repo) and on top right corner click the paper with a turning arrow.
